Project description

This project aims to ameliorate the potentially damaging effects of riparian grazing.

Grazing of river banks by livestock can remove riparian habitat and cause soil to enter the river. This project hopes to provide information and advice to riparian graziers about the potentially damaging effects of overgrazing adjacent to the river, and help provide ways of ameliorating these damaging impacts through agreed bankside fencing projects.
